How many forex pairs and CFDs are available to trade?
Trade360 provides traders 49 currency pairs (e.g., EUR/USD) compared to VT Markets's 39 available pairs. Forex pairs aside, Trade360 offers traders access to 1062 CFDs while VT Markets has 168 available CFDs, a difference of 894.

Is VT Markets good?
VT Markets benefits from being part of the Vantage Group of companies, and provides access to the MetaTrader suite of platforms as well as its own VT Pro trading app.
Is Trade360 good?
Trade360 offers over a thousand symbols on its innovative app for web and mobile. It also supports MetaTrader 5 (MT5), making it a versatile platform for forex and CFD trading. That said, Trade360โs market research and educational content are limited, and spreads are fairly expensive compared to peers.
